As we enter the sacred season of Lent, we are invited into a time of renewal, reflection, and a deeper commitment to Christ. Lent calls us to return to the heart of our faith through the three pillars of this holy season: prayer, fasting, and almsgiving.
🙏 Prayer draws us closer to God. Through Mass, Eucharistic Adoration, the Rosary, Scripture reading, and quiet personal reflection, we open our hearts to hear His voice more clearly.
🍞 Fasting helps us detach from worldly comforts and unite our sacrifices to Christ’s own sacrifice. By giving up something meaningful, we create space for spiritual growth and greater reliance on God.
🤝 Almsgiving calls us to put love into action. It is a concrete expression of mercy — caring for those most in need and recognizing Christ in the poor and vulnerable.
